Lauren Mitchell The year 2016 was one of large-scale and unexpected change for Tampa Bay area blues and soul vocalistLauren Mitchell. During a tumultuous time in both her personal and professional life, she was given the opportunity to rise from the challenges she was facing and make the album of her career with producer Tony Braunagel. Mitchell took the leap of faith because she is a true student of the blues, a music that’s all about finding a way to transform difficult experiences into something cathartic. The timing was perfect. She had an album to record. That album, “Desire,” is her most fully realized musical statement to date. Through a bold mix of her own original material, songs she hand-picked from the repertoires of her friends, and select covers of tunes first performed by Etta James, Bettye Lavette, Diana Ross, Aretha Franklin and Betty Davis, Mitchell tells a blues story that’s been a lifetime in the making. It’s a stylistically varied set of 13 songs expertly recorded by drummer and Grammy-winning producer Tony Braunagel, whose work with Bonnie Raitt, Taj Mahal andRobert Cray have made him one of today’s most in-demand blues industry professionals. Recorded during a ten-day trip to Los Angeles, Braunagel brought out the best in Mitchell, highlighting every nuance in her powerful vocals and helping her craft an emotionally resonant album that’s destined to go down as one of the year’s highlights. Besides Braunagel, the band features guitarists Johnny Lee Schell and Josh Sklair, keyboardist Jim Pugh, bassist Reggie McBride, sax player Joe Sublett, trumpet player Darrell Leonard, and percussionist Lenny Castro. “The blues is a song of victory,” Mitchell says. “It’s a way to say, ‘I’m over it,’ and now I’m turning it into this beautiful thing that can help someone else heal. w/ Victoria Ginty & Ladyhawke Indie Blues and Roots artist Victoria Ginty is no stranger to tough competition, she was a successful recording artist with BMG Critique Records in Nashville before the contraction of the industry and subsequent folding of her label. Blues fans know that Florida is a hotbed of talent in the genre. The Suncoast Blues Society has sent some of the finest artists to the IBC’s year after year. Selwyn Birchwood was their most recent winner, and they’ve consistently produced semi-finalist. “I didn’t realize how rich the talent in Florida is until I started playing the venues up and down the coasts.” says Ginty. “We are frequently playing the week or day before, or after some of the best Blues artist in the country!”, and Victoria Ginty and Ladyhawke fit the bill! Andy Snipper of Music-News says “She has a terrific voice, loaded with sultry undertones and a sassy edge that sets the hairs on the back of my neck at attention and the band behind her cook like a New Orleans Gumbo jamboree. Seriously, this is Blues and soul of the highest order and her music is classic but not ‘retro’”. Victoria has just finished a new studio Album, “Unfinished Business”, released in May of 2018, of mostly original material. It debuted on the RMR Contemporary Blues Album Charts at #17. Ginty says, “I can’t tell you how excited I am to have a new project with so much original material, and I had great co-writers contributing as well, including Grammy nominated Mike Alan Ward and members of my band.  In Nashville I had some success as a songwriter, but this project has been a lifetime in the making”. Victoria is currently working on a Fall/Winter 2018 tour in support of the new record with her band “Victoria Ginty and Ladyhawke”(guitarist Tim Costello, Mike Ivey on Bass, Nick Lauro drums, Wayne Cornelius sax, and hoping to be joined by Chuck Weirich on Trumpet and Rick Toledo on keys). “Unfinished Business” is the second project recorded with Ginty since forming her current band, “Victoria Ginty and Ladyhawke”. The first was a live album recorded at a performance at the Firehouse Cultural Center in Tampa Bay. The expanded  (7 piece) version of the band performed before a sold out crowd featuring Ginty on lead vocals, violin, and acoustic guitar, Tim Costello, vocals and lead guitar, Taylor John, vocals and keyboard, Mike Ivey, vocals and bass guitar, Bob Nesbitt, drums, Chuck Weirich, Trumpet, and Wayne Cornelius, Tenor Sax. “We love having the opportunity to bring out the big band” say Ginty, “Younger audience members often comment how great it is to see and hear ‘real music’ when we perform at venues that can afford our full band, and really this genre benefits from being presented the way it’s meant to be played, organically.” The new studio project also has many tracks featuring horns, Hammond, and percussion as well as pared down to vocals,bass, drums, and guitar. The record (11 tracks, 8 originals) is a story shared by so many of us, of life’s ups and downs, loves and love lost, songs written for adults but without explicit content.
